Rob Dobson
Director @ Float
Edinburgh, United Kingdom
Rob Dobson is a seed investor at Float in Edinburgh focused on Software and SaaS. Rob founded Actix (actix.com) in 1991 and as CEO (1991-2005) grew it to over $50m revenue by 2005. More than 90% of the world’s mobile phone customers have their networks optimized by Actix software and Rob has worked with many of the world’s leading mobile operators and infrastructure vendors. In 2005 he sold a majority stake in the company toPE firm Summit Partners at a $100+m valuation. He has invested in a further 30+ startups and has had five very successful exits (he's not counting failures as they come with the territory). Rob is chairman of Robotical (robotical.io) and DevicePilot.com. He's also the founding chairman of Singletrack.com and a supporter of the unique orchestra SouthbankSinfonia.co.uk. As an inveterate tinkerer in software and hardware, he's fascinated by IoT, 3D printing and the maker movement (as you can probably see from his personal website (robdobson.com). Rob is a Fellow of the IET and has a 1st class honours degree in Electronic Engineering.

FAQ
What does Rob Dobson invest in?
Rob Dobson invests primarily in Software, SaaS and E-Commerce startups, most often at Seed and Pre-Seed stage. Most of the 22 investments tracked by Shizune back companies in United Kingdom. The Investment Focus section breaks down every industry, stage and country in the portfolio.
What is Rob Dobson's check size?
Rob Dobson typically joins rounds of $638k–$1.8M at Seed and $39k–$1.7M at Pre-Seed. These ranges are 10th–90th percentile round sizes calculated from confirmed public funding rounds, so they are a realistic guide to the rounds Rob Dobson participates in.
